SAP Unveils Sovereign AI Cloud for European Union

German software giant partners with Cohere to offer localized infrastructure meeting strict EU data residency rules.

SAP launched the EU AI Cloud, partnering with Cohere to provide sovereign AI infrastructure. The solution ensures data processing remains within the EU, targeting regulated industries and complying with strict residency laws.

SAP launched the "EU AI Cloud", a specialized infrastructure offering designed to meet the European Union's strict data residency and sovereignty requirements. The German enterprise software company partnered with Canadian model developer Cohere to integrate "Cohere North" models into the SAP Business Technology Platform (BTP). This launch targets highly regulated European industries that have been hesitant to adopt AI solutions reliant on U.S.-based servers.
